In photos: Memorable wet-weather drives

– Red Bull teenager Max Verstappen delivered a stunning performance at the recent Brazilian Grand Prix, fighting his way through the field from 16th to the podium in treacherous weather conditions. In response, GPUpdate.net picks out some other magical wet-weather Formula 1 drives, from the 1960s to the modern day.1963 Belgian Grand Prix: Jim Clark Jim Clark lined up on the third row of the grid for the Belgian Grand Prix, after gearbox issues in qualifying. At the start of a wet race, he jumped off the line to clear the seven cars ahead of him and lead on the opening lap.
